JOB SUMMARY
We are seeking an Executive Assistant (EA) to join our growing team and provide administrative support to our organization within one of our growing functions.
This job is for you if you are flexible, enjoy working in a dynamic environment, can manage multiple tasks, and not afraid of making recommendations to create better ways of working. This position requires initiative, tact, and where needed partnership to address potential problems as they arise.
Responsibilities:
- Provide administrative partnership for complex calendar management, planning, arranging domestic and international travel, and creating expense reports
- Provide calendar support to the aligned leader and partner closely with the team to align on operating rhythm and cadences
- Plan and coordinate events and multi-day meetings including preparation of meeting materials, logistics, food, agenda, amenities, activities, and communications with attendees
- Develop and maintain positive working relationships with internal and outside parties, including high-level contacts of a sensitive nature
- Partner with other EAs to coordinate and manage tradeoffs and prioritization
- Maintain email aliases, distribution lists and shared directories
- Support contract execution and ensure department bills are paid promptly and manage departmental purchases
- Provide staff meeting support, including preparing agendas, taking notes as needed, and distributing meeting minutes and presentations on occasion

Executive & Operational Support
- Manage complex calendars, priorities, and logistics with a focus on optimizing executive time
- Anticipate needs and proactively solve problems before they arise
- Act as a liaison across teams, ensuring clear communication and follow-through
-
Meeting & Team Operations
- Own end-to-end management of team meetings and leadership forums:
- Build and distribute agendas
- Solicit input and materials from stakeholders
- Ensure meetings are well-structured and run on time
- Capture high-quality notes, decisions, and action items
- Follow up on action items to ensure accountability and progress
-
Content & Communication Support
- Synthesize information into concise summaries and materials
- Support internal communications and messaging as needed
Minimum Qualifications:
- 2+ years of experience providing administrative support to senior leveled leaders
- Strong written and verbal communication skills
- Excellent interpersonal skills
- Strong detail orientation and solid analytical skills
- Comfort with Microsoft Office Suite (Outlook, PowerPoint, Teams, Word, and Excel)
- Willingness to adapt to a rapidly changing environment and new processes and responsibilities
- Collaborative team player and team building skills
- Knowledge of business issues and needs and the ability to work within a matrixed organization
- Knowledge of office management practices and procedures
- Ability to travel to events or internal meetings, locally and internationally
